From: c-Src-dependent EGF receptor transactivation contributes to ET-1-induced COX-2 expression in brain microvascular endothelial cells

Figure 3

ET-1-induced COX-2 expression is mediated through PI3K/Akt cascade. (A,B) Cells were pretreated with various concentrations of LY294002 (3, 30, or 300 nM) or SH-5 (1, 10, or 100 nM) for 1 h, and incubated with 10 nM ET-1 for 6 h (A) or 1 h (B). (C) Time dependence of ET-1-induced Akt phosphorylation; cells were treated with 10 nM ET-1 for the indicated time intervals in the presence or absence of SH-5 (10 nM). The phosphorylation of Akt was analyzed by Western blot using an anti-phospho-Akt antibody. (D) Cells were transfected with p85 (sh-p85) or Akt (sh-Akt) shRNA for 24 h (Topo: as a control) and incubated with 10 nM ET-1 for 6 h. The COX-2 protein (A,D) and mRNA (B) were analyzed by Western blotting and RT-PCR, respectively. Data are expressed as mean ± SEM of three individual experiments (n = 3). * P < 0.05, # P < 0.01 as compared with cells stimulated by ET-1 alone.
